Schedule 4 veterinary drugs

WebYou will need this licence if you intend to sell, supply, possess or administer a Schedule 4 (S4) or Schedule 8 (S8) drug. S4 drugs are prescription only medicine or prescription animal remedy. S8 drugs are controlled drugs. Service type. Licence. WebSchedule 4 – prescription only medicine or prescription animal remedy; Schedule 5 – caution; Schedule 6 – poison; Schedule 7 – dangerous poison; Schedule 8 – controlled drug; Schedule 9 – prohibited substances. Schedule 10 – strictly prohibited substances; Substances in schedules 9 and 10 are only available under strictly defined ...

WebFeb 9, 2024 · Prescription validity: Prescriptions for Schedule 2, 3 and 4 CDs are only valid for 28 days after the appropriate date (i.e. date of signing unless the prescriber indicates a date before which the CD should not be dispensed). Note: a prescriber may forward-date a CD prescription in which case the date of validity is 28 days after the forward ... WebSupply of Schedule 4 drugs on receipt of a written order. Regulation 21. Pharmacists are permitted to supply Schedule 4 drugs on receipt of a written order to: a council or health service for use in an immunisation program, a health professional authorised to supply or administer the drug such as a medical practitioner, nurse practitioner or ...
